Description

Set within the sought-after coastal village of Port Seton, this beautifully presented detached bungalow offers bright, spacious accommodation all on one level. With a private garden and just a short stroll from the beautiful coastal promenade, this property enjoys the perfect balance of peaceful seaside living and comfort.

Set within the popular coastal village of Port Seton, this spacious detached bungalow offers bright, well-proportioned accommodation all on one level, making it an excellent choice for downsizers, professionals, first-time buyers or those seeking accessible living.

The accommodation comprises a welcoming entrance, a generous lounge, a contemporary fitted kitchen featuring white cabinetry, warm wooden worktops and attractive wood-effect flooring, two well-proportioned double bedrooms with newly fitted cosy carpets, and a modern shower room complete with a spacious double-sized walk-in shower.

The property has been tastefully presented throughout with fresh neutral décor, allowing buyers to move straight in while adding their own personal style.

Externally, the home enjoys low-maintenance front and rear gardens, with the fully enclosed private rear garden offering an excellent degree of privacy as it is not overlooked. Two external sheds provide valuable additional storage, while the private driveway offers convenient off-street parking.

Further benefits include mains gas central heating, double glazing throughout and excellent outdoor space rarely found with properties of this size.

Thomson Crescent enjoys a sought-after position within the charming coastal village of Port Seton, just a two-minute walk from the picturesque promenade and shoreline, perfect for coastal walks, cycling and enjoying the surrounding scenery.

Everyday amenities are close at hand, including the local pharmacy, GP and community centre, with a wider range of shops and leisure facilities available in nearby Prestonpans and Tranent.

The property is well connected for commuters, with a bus stop approximately a 15-minute walk away offering direct services into Edinburgh, while the nearby A1 provides straightforward road access to Edinburgh, East Lothian and beyond.

Families are well served by local primary and secondary schools within the Prestonpans catchment area (purchasers should verify school catchments with East Lothian Council).

Combining peaceful coastal living with excellent local amenities and convenient transport links, Port Seton remains one of East Lothian's most desirable seaside communities.
